A major step toward large soap making took place in 1791 when a French drug store, Nicholas Leblanc, patented a procedure for making soda ash from table salt. Soda ash is obtained from ashes and can be incorporated with fat to create soap. This exploration made soap-making among America's fastest-growing markets by 1850, together with other advancements and development of power to run manufacturing facilities.

During World Battle I and again in Globe Battle II, there was a shortage of animal and veggie fats and oils that were used in making soap. Today, many points we call "soap" are in fact detergents.


Hot procedure makes use of an external warm resource to bring the soap to gel stage, where it is then poured into the mold and mildew. This is in contrast to cold process, which does not utilize exterior warmth; the heat is internally produced throughout saponification and the soap might or might not go into gel phase.

Nevertheless, numerous soapmakers like HP due to it's quick turnaround; numerous soaps can be utilized the complying with day (although a longer treatment time is advised for a more challenging bar). There are a few vital things you'll need in order to embark on your very first warm processing trip. For this short article, we will be covering hot process soap made in a crockery pot.


(https://www.avitop.com/cs/members/sthrntrls4op.aspx)This can be the most challenging step for new soapmakers. When handled correctly, lye is completely risk-free. With your apron, goggles and gloves firmly in position, mix your lye right into your water; never ever, ever before put your water into your lye: this may cause a negative and dangerous response. Mix the water with your selected wood or silicone spatula as you are sprinkling the lye in to keep it well mixed.


Keep in mind that it will certainly fume - this is the chemical response taking place. You will certainly also notice that integrating the lye and water will create fumes; this is completely normal. Do your ideal not to take in these fumes. Once you have actually mixed your lye remedy, look at your oils.
